A Brief Guide To Event Photography

Event photography has always been an attractive career for the creative minds. An event photographer is paid handsomely for his talent in taking photos of different events, such as weddings, business events, and sports events. The significance of event photography is that it allows people to protect their memories of important occasions and recall them later through the photos.

Event photography is an excellent alternative for all those expert photographers who are well trained. However, to do a great job, there are some guidelines that must be kept in mind.

The first and foremost point to consider is the kind of event that is being photographed and the intended use of the pictures. For instance, if you are photographing a corporate event, where the photos are intended to be published in an in-house magazine, then you should concentrate on the exact proceedings of the event and develop a sequence of photos that show how the event unfolded. On the other hand, if you are photographing a private party, then it would be much wiser to concentrate on the people, especially their faces.

Attentiveness is a key characteristic in event photography. You should be completely attentive to the developments during the event and should be aware of when to click photos. Clients also like to appoint photographers who can understand the proceedings themselves and do not have to be constantly told to click a picture. This is a skill which comes with experience but you have to make a constant effort on your part.

Familiarity with the site where the event is being held is helpful during event photography. You should be aware of the spots where most of the action is going to take place and the perfect spots that would allow you to click good photographs of the event.

The photographer should also have the technical knowledge of the camera and its settings so that photographs involving tough angles can be conveniently taken without losing out on any important moment of the event. Lighting is a crucial part of photography and a good event photographer must learn about the amount of light that will be available at the site. On the basis of this knowledge, you must be ready with proper equipment and with the camera in the right settings.

Lastly, every event photographer must have a cheerful personality. You ought to be able to mingle with the group that you would photograph. When you can associate with the group and imbibe the essence of the event, your subjects will be comfortable and the photos will come out a lot better.
